Clay-shoveler's fracture is a stable fracture through the spinous process of a vertebra occurring at any of the lower cervical or upper thoracic vertebrae, classically at C6 or C7. [1] In Australia in the 1930s, men digging deep ditches tossed clay 10 to 15 feet above their heads using long handled shovels. [2] Instead of separating, the sticky clay would sometimes stick to the shovel. At the top of the arc of motion, with the arms extended, the worker may hear a pop and feel a sudden pain between the shoulder blades, unable to continue working. [3] [4]
